Relationship therapy with me is designed to provide a safe and supportive environment where you can explore and strengthen their relationships. With extensive experience and specialized training, I understand the complexities and challenges that relationships can face. Whether you are dealing with communication issues, trust and infidelity, or navigating non-traditional relationship structures, I am here to help.

My approach integrates Cognitive Behavior Therapy (CBT) and the Developmental Model of Couples Therapy to provide a comprehensive and effective treatment plan. In our sessions, we will focus on improving communication skills, resolving conflicts, and enhancing emotional connection. By viewing your relationship dynamics objectively, CBT helps identify and change behaviors that may be causing harm. The Developmental Model of Couples Therapy delves into the influences shaping your current relationship styles, helping you and your partner(s) know yourselves and each other better, and manage conflicts more skillfully.

Building trust and emotional intimacy is essential for a healthy relationship. We will work together to address issues such as infidelity and broken agreements, fostering an environment where trust can be rebuilt and strengthened. For those in non-traditional relationship structures, including open and polyamorous relationships or kink/BDSM dynamics, my therapy provides the support and guidance needed to navigate these unique relational landscapes with confidence and mutual respect.

The long-term effects of relationship therapy can lead to stronger, more resilient relationships with improved communication, deeper understanding, and enhanced emotional connection. By addressing the root causes of relational issues and developing effective strategies for managing conflicts, you and your partner(s) can achieve a more fulfilling and harmonious relationship.

Do you accept insurance?

I do not accept insurance directly. However, if you have out-of-network benefits, you may be able to get reimbursed for a percentage of the session cost after meeting your deductible. You would pay the full fee at each session, and I can provide you with a superbill to submit to your insurance company for reimbursement. Please check with your insurance provider for specific details about your coverage and out-of-network benefits.

How do I know if therapy is working?

Progress in therapy can be measured in various ways, such as improvements in mood, changes in behavior, better coping strategies, and enhanced relationships. We will set specific goals at the beginning of our work together and regularly review them to track your progress. You might notice positive changes in how you feel, think, and interact with others. Open communication about your experiences and feelings during therapy will also help ensure that we are on the right track.
